Choosing a Double Pushchair With Car Seat
Double pushchairs are great for families with twins or infants and toddlers. Double pushchairs can accommodate two children in one seat and a carrycot can be added if necessary.
They usually have a large number of seating configurations and can fit through most doorways/hallways. They're a little bit longer than side-by-side buggies however they are more stable and can be used on the kerbs.
Easy to maneuver
There are a variety of things to consider when choosing the best double stroller for your family. First, you should look at the size and weight of the buggy, and also the mechanism for folding wheels, as well as the fabrications and wheels. If possible, try to purchase a double pushchair and car seat from a trusted brand, as it will provide the highest price for resales in the near future.
There are two types of double pushchairs: tandem and side-by-side. Side-by-side buggies are equipped with fixed seats that are placed in a row, side-by-side. they can be suitable for twins or children of various ages. However they are generally wider than single pushchairs and might be difficult to fit through some doors or narrow paths. They can be also heavy and lengthy to push, particularly if the children in the car seats are in the front.
Tandem buggies offer more flexibility in that they can be arranged in many different ways. One or both seats can face forward or backwards. They're more expensive than side-by-side pushchairs, however they are more convenient to fold and move. Many of them also have large shopping baskets that can be accessed even when the seats are in a fully reclined position.
Another thing to think about is whether the double pushchair comes with an locking front wheel. This will make it easier to navigate tricky terrain and transitions, while also ensuring that your little ones remain secure and comfortable. Look at the storage space and see if it is accessible. This will be useful in the event that you have to go through lots of grocery shopping while having two children.
Find out how easy the straps and buckles are to operate when buying a double stroller that comes with a car seat. Some buckles are simple and only require one hand for operation and others are more complex and require two hands. Find out if it comes with an padded strap for the crotch and an adjustable shoulder height. These features are crucial for keeping your child safe.

Comfortable seats
A good double pushchair with car seat can provide comfortable seats for your children. The seats should be cushioned, and the harnesses should be easy to use. The straps should be easily adjustable for height and the buckles should not require two hands. They must be durable and strong enough to withstand repeated use. If the buckles are difficult to operate, they may be unsafe and must be replaced. The seats should be capable of recline and have UPF 50+ canopy with windows that can be seen through. The recline feature is utilized by infants to nap or older toddlers to observe the world around them.
